North Kansas City Hospital is an acute care hospital located in North Kansas City, Missouri at 2800 Clay Edwards Drive.

Hospital Background

North Kansas City Hospital is a 451-licensed-bed and 72-acre (29 ha) campus containing the hospital itself, Health Services Pavilion encompassing patient rooms, outpatient services, offices for Hospital staff, physician offices and a conference center. Health Center North is the location for Home Health Services and NorthCare Hospice. There are two physician office buildings that are known as Medical Plaza North and Professional Building North. It opened on March 30, 1958 as an 80-bed facility.

The hospital was the second hospital client for an electronic medical record system developed by Cerner. In 2005 Cerner moved its world headquarters across the street from the hospital.[1]
